Postural instability was quantitatively studied in patients with lesions in the 1) pontine tegmentum, 2) deep cerebellar nuclei, or 3) cerebellar hemisphere. As compared to controls, patients with each lesion demonstrated a characteristic 3 Hertz (Hz) body oscillation. Cross-correlation functions revealed a strong correlation between the body sway and activities in the lower leg muscles. Based on these findings, we conclude that the 3 Hz body oscillation may be the result of any disturbance in the loop of long-latency reflexes mediated by the cerebellum.
